Abstract
The utility model provides a rock core imbibition experimental apparatus, include: constant temperature equipment, constant voltage equipment, electronic balance, imbibition cup, imbibition liquid pipe and rock core gallows, placed in the constant temperature equipment and be equipped with imbibition liquid the imbibition cup to keep predetermined temperature in the messenger constant temperature equipment, constant voltage equipment is through passing constant temperature equipment imbibition liquid pipe with the imbibition cup is connected, so that in the imbibition cup the level of imbibition liquid remains stationary, electronic balance place in on constant temperature equipment's the top surface, electronic balance is through passing constant temperature equipment the rock core gallows is connected with the rock core, is used for weighing the mass parameter of rock core, wherein, rock core suspension and submergence in in the imbibition liquid for the mass parameter of the gained rock core of rock core imbibition experimental apparatus obtains under the condition of constant temperature and constant voltage, improves and tests the accuracy.

Background technology
In compact oil reservoir and low-permeability oil deposit displacement or the research handled up etc., by utilize rock core hole with
Imbibition between substrate and substrate and crack thus obtain the imbibition effect of rock core, become important research class
Topic.
In the prior art, often utilize high-precision indoor experimental apparatus to the rock under different experimental conditions
The imbibition yield of the heart carries out quantitative, qualitative.In existing imbibition experiment, mainly utilize mass method to imbibition
Effect is tested: its experimental provision is based on balance, counterweight, beaker, by utilizing lever principle
Weighing is immersed in the core quality in imbibition liquid thus calculates imbibition rate.Its experimental provision is owing to using sky
Flat lever is experiment basis, and error is the biggest;The more important thing is, due to experimental provision it cannot be guaranteed that measurement ring
The stationarity in border so that measuring environment and change, such as variations in temperature and imbibition liquid volatilization etc., cause
There is change in experiment condition, has a strong impact on the accuracy of experiment.
Therefore, in existing rock core imbibition is tested, it is badly in need of one and can ensure that experiment condition and experimental situation
Stablize, enable experiment not by ectocine thus obtain the experimental provision of experimental result accurately.

The structural representation of a kind of rock core imbibition experimental provision that Fig. 1 provides for this utility model embodiment one
Figure, as it is shown in figure 1, this rock core imbibition experimental provision includes: thermostat 1, constant voltage equipment 2, electronics
Balance 3, imbibition cup 4, imbibition fluid catheter 5 and rock core suspension bracket 6;
The imbibition cup 4 equipped with imbibition liquid it is placed with, so that keeping pre-in thermostat 1 in thermostat 1
If temperature.
Wherein, imbibition liquid concretely saline, oil or the liquid such as distilled water, in order to imbibition liquid enters with rock core
Row liquid displacement, i.e. ensures that imbibition liquid composition is different from the fluid composition in rock core, and the application is to this
Do not limit.Thermostat 1 concretely small-sized thermostat, or be temperature-adjustable and holding temperature
Any one constant thermostat, more preferably, the sidewall of thermostat 1 is also provided with observe
Window, in order to research worker observation experiment is in progress.
Constant voltage equipment 2 is connected with imbibition cup 4 by the imbibition fluid catheter 5 through thermostat 1, so that
The level height of the imbibition liquid in imbibition cup 4 keeps fixing.
Concrete, constant voltage equipment 2 is by the imbibition fluid catheter 5 through thermostat 1 with imbibition cup 4 even
Connect, so that when volatilization occurs in the imbibition liquid in imbibition cup 4, and imbibition fluid catheter 5 and imbibition cup 4 occur
When the pressure of junction declines, constant voltage equipment 2 supplements imbibition by imbibition fluid catheter 5 in imbibition cup 4
Liquid, thus ensure that the level height of the imbibition liquid in imbibition cup 4 is fixed, make experiment condition tend towards stability and carry
The accuracy of high experimental result.
Electronic balance 3 is positioned on the end face of thermostat 1, and electronic balance 3 is by through thermostat
The rock core suspension bracket 6 of 1 is connected with rock core 7, for weighing the mass parameter of rock core 7;Wherein, rock core 7
Suspend and be immersed in imbibition liquid.
Concrete, the top of rock core suspension bracket 6 is connected with the object stage of electronic balance 3, rock core suspension bracket 6
Bottom is connected with rock core 7, and ensures that rock core 7 suspends and is immersed in the imbibition liquid in imbibition cup 4, with
Ensure that all surfaces of rock core 7 can carry out liquid displacement with imbibition liquid.And electronic balance 3 passes through rock core
The mass parameter of rock core 7 can be weighed by suspension bracket 6, and its minimum measurement unit can be accurate to 0.0001 gram.
